AS3面向对象编程,关于创建class(类)例子
发布网友
发布时间:2022-04-22 07:59
我来回答
共2个回答
热心网友
时间:2022-06-18 05:10
Hello既然是文档类,那么它必须是Sprite或MovieClip的子类,因为文档类链接的是一个fla文件,而fla自身是一个舞台显示容器对象,如果不继承显示容器基类,就会报错。正确代码是
package
{
import flash.display.MovieClip;
public class Hello extends MovieClip
{
public var helloString:String = 'World';
public function Hello() { }
public function sayHello():void { trace ("Hello," + helloString + "!"); }
}
}
热心网友
时间:2022-06-18 05:11
你写的类没问题
在fla中的舞台动作帧打如下代码(new Hello()).sayHello();
还有,上面回答那位不要误导新人,输出一个Hello World还弄出一堆显示容器不显示容器的,没必要